Kashmir’s religious body MMU appeals for peace and unity

Srinagar, July 20 (UNI) A day after Jammu and Kashmir Waqf Board said that action has been initiated against those who tried to allegedly hurt the sectarian cordiality, Muttahida Majlis-e-Ulama (MMU) on Saturday appealed for peace and unity.

MMU, the umbrella organisation of all major Islamic sects in Jammu and Kashmir, including some social and educational institutions and headed by Mirwaiz Umar Farooq , urged for peace and concord on the current sectarian controversy at Khanqah-e- Moula Srinagar.

“Known from the very beginning for its unique identity and composition based on unity, sectarian harmony and mutual solidarity, people of JK should not allow any group or agency to disrupt this legacy for their vested interests . The people of Kashmir cannot afford such divisions,” MMU said in a statement while stressing the need to show restraint and patience.

A controversy erupted when some Shia members held mourning inside the famous Sunni shrine of Khanqah-e-Moula in the old Srinagar.

“A planned attempt to hurt the sectarian cordiality was made by some today at Khankah-e-Moula. J&K Waqf Board has taken cognisance of the matter & action has been initiated. No body will be allowed to create any sectarian divide and stern action is being taken,” Waqf Board chairperson Darakhshan Andrabi posted on X on Friday evening.

In a statement on Saturday, MMU said that it seems that this incident was a “planned” and “mischievous” attempt to hurt the sentiments, which needs to be investigated.

The MMU said while it is the duty of the Wakf board to unearth the truth behind this mischief as they are the custodians of the shrines and maintaining their sanctity, the umbrella organisation has also decided the formation of a committee consisting of responsible members from both sects to investigate and identify the elements involved in this incident.

“The committee will submit its report in some time after which MMU will follow up on this matter ,” the statement said.
